As a new user of Ubuntu 8.10 Intrepid Ibex I question whether a hard copy instruction manual is really helpful.

I think that it must be akin to "Windows for Dummies".

It would be helpful if you were a dummy but you are not.

Ubuntu 8.10 comes with a simple help button - the blue circle with the question mark.

There is also an extensive online help

and if you still need help there is an online forum.

As a former Windows XP user I am most impressed by Ubuntu 8.10,

especially after trying and failing with earlier versions of Linux like Red Hat and Suse.

It is possible to do most things and it is free!
